Komputiloj, Programado
CSS z-indekso: superrigardon, ecoj
Regulo CSS z-indekso - paĝon elemento pozicio koordinato Z: la nivelo de la display elemento aŭ tavolo en kiu ĝi situas. Etikedo kiu havas z-indekso pli granda estos montrata en plena. Etikedoj estas montrata en la ordo aperas en la alvenanta fluo kaj solapan. приоритет видимости. Z-indekso valoro determinas la videblecon prioritato.
Ni devas omaĝi al modernaj retumiloj kaj algoritmoj display elementoj. De post la tempo, kiam grafikaĵoj kaj kaptis ekranoj formis tondaĵo problemo videbla kaj nevidebla partoj de la elementoj en la apliko fenestro, la videbla ekrano teknologio enhavo atingis bonegajn rezultojn. En retumilo fenestro, ĉiuj eroj estas montrata ĝuste, la uzanto vidas nur kio estas precizigita dezajno aŭ ellaboranto.
La ĝenerala regulo: la ordo kaj la nivelo de
La fluo de eniro (paĝo formis servilo) sinsekve legas la retumilo. Ĉiuj etikedoj estas montrita laŭ la CSS reguloj kaj povas koincidas.
Tiu ekzemplo priskribas kvar videbla elemento. Ĉiu plua parte kovras la antaŭa. En lokoj kie la etikedoj estas krucigitaj, estas demando de prioritato. Kutime z-indekso CSS etikedoj por ĉiuj ĉi tiuj samaj kaj egala al 848, ĝi estos ŝajna ke elemento kiu iras jene. Ĉio peeks el sub ĉiu el la sekva elemento, ŝajne.
regulo videbleco
Retumiloj observi la regulojn de videbleco nur "justa". Por elpensi algoritmo kiu permesas vin analizi la tutan malneta altrudo kaj uzi nur tiuj kiuj vere sekci, ekskludante la parto, kiu estas sorbitaj de ĉiu sinsekva elemento - estas tre malfacila.
Plejofte tio ne necesas. Moderna ekipaĵo estas tre rapida, kaj rimarki redibujar elemento al la punkto kie ĝi blokos la sekva elemento, estas tre problema.
Influo sur la elemento tabelo
Sufiĉas la tria tag scCSS3 pliigi la z-indekso, kaj ĉe scCSS4 - redukti ĝin, la tuta bildo estas ŝanĝita. La sekvenco de elementoj en la fluo restas la sama:
- id= 'scCSS1'; div id = 'scCSS1';
- id= 'scCSS2'; div id = 'scCSS2';
- id= 'scCSS3'; div id = 'scCSS3';
- id= 'scCSS4'. div id = 'scCSS4'.
Ni notu, ke la dua bildo estas vere prenas pli da spaco de kio similas. La tria bildo estas la samaj. Plue, ĝi konsistas de du partoj (du ovojn) je distanco de unu la alian.
La fakta grandeco de la regionoj, kiuj okupas la duan kaj trian bildoj estas elstarigitaj en flava kaj griza respektive.
La kombino de z-indekso por fono-koloro
Estas notinde ke la proprietoj de CSS fono & z-indekso kompletigas unu la alian. Ĉiuj bloko-nivelo elementoj, kaj ĉiu alia, ĉiam okupi rektangula areo formita de la maksimuma alteco kaj la maksimuma larĝo de la enhavo.
Uzante bildoj, Vi povas fari ajnan formon kampo elemento, sed ĉirkaŭe ĉiam estos rektangulo. Estas fakto, ke estas grave konsideri konvene.
Vi povas meti tekston sur vojo elektita formon, sed se ne, la enhavo ricevas al ajna elemento en rektangula skatolo, sinsekve, sur kvitanco de la enigo.
Uzo ecoj CSS z-indekso en la elemento kies fono-koloro valoro estas travidebla (ia travidebleco), povas emular iu cirkviton elemento. Kvankam ĉiuokaze reale elemento estas rektangula.
Eventoj kaj videblaj elementoj
En lokoj kie la elemento estas blokita de alia elemento, la okazaĵoj ĝi ne funkcios. Kiel ĝenerala regulo, se la ero estas el la vido, li ankaŭ estas la havebleco zono.
Se ellaboranto volas ŝlosi la butono aŭ menuero, ĝi bone povas esti metitaj sur la blokado etikedo alia etikedo, eble travidebla (ekz, uzante la regulo de CSS opakeco), sed en ajna kazo, havante pli altan CSS z-indekso.
Ekde la okazaĵo, de la uzanto vidpunkto, povas esti dividita en gravaj kaj ne havas, tiam la lasta (movante la muso, premante hazardaj butonoj sur la klavaro, la temporizador signalo) povas esti uzita por adekvate ŝanĝi la enhavon en la retumilo fenestro.
Simpla ekzemplo: vizitanton movis la muskursoron sur la menuero, sed ankoraŭ ne decidis fari ion. La ellaboranto povus provizi okazaĵo por spuri la movadon de dialogo al la dezirata punkto (klaku - vizitanton decidas) kaj montri taŭgan enhavon. Regulo CSS z-indekso estas la plej taŭga por la okazo.
Bildformato
Ekde bildoj estas grava konstrumaterialo por ajna loko (beleco, modernidad, funcionalidad - estas la kutima normo de aferoj), estas de granda graveco por la bildo formato elektojn.
De kaj granda, vi povas uzi ĉiujn diversajn ekzistantajn formatoj, sed en terminoj de praktikeco kaj efikeco estas sufiĉe racia por internigi * .png por statikaj bildoj kaj * .gif - por vigla bildoj. Popularaj * .jpg estas ankaŭ bona, sed ĝi ne permesas la flekseblecon por manipuli la display spaco.
Foliumilo cimojn kaj la ellaboranto
Ne tiel ofte okazas, kiam la CSS z-indekso ne funkcias, sed ĝi okazas. Kondiĉoj de akvofalo stilo littukojn ĉiam funkcias, kaj la volumeno de stilo dosiero ofte atingas signifan volumoj. Kiam io ne estas montrata, aŭ simple ne havas kio devas esti, devas unue kontroli viajn proprajn kodo, do purigi vian retumilan kaŝmemoron kaj testi vian propran kodon denove.
Interpretante HTML kaj CSS, la retumilo estas preskaŭ ne faras erarojn - tio estas aksiomo. Se la deziratan elemento ne, do, en la dezajno de CSS {pozicio: absoluta; z-indekso: 112233; maldekstra: 10px; supro: 20px; } ... io mankas aŭ ne registrita.
La plej ofta eraro - malĝusta Montrita elemento mankas referenco al ĝia videbleco sur absoluta aŭ relativa pozicio. Kelkfoje povas labori specifi la stilon rekte sur la elemento kaj ne estas lia stilo. En la lasta kazo, ĝi estas elirejo, sed estas ĉefe parolas ian eraron en la kodo.
Stilo devas esti en la klaso aŭ ID stilo. Montrante stilo sur la elemento devus nur en esceptaj kazoj.
Uzante jQuery.css (z-indekso, 123) povas ankaŭ konduki al eraro, se ne aplikis al la klaso aŭ identigilon. Krome, jQuery - vere rimarkinda disvolviĝo ilo. Tamen, antaŭ ol apliki ĝin, ne doloras pensi: ĉu eblas malhavi improvizis signifas HTML / CSS, z-indekso - ne estas regulo kiu ne postulas tujan atenton.
Ĝusta movado de la logika tavoloj kaj
Perfekta Page - plata. Ĉiukaze, antaŭ la reala tridimensian bildon en la fora masiva skalo, kaj ne en tiu aparta bezono. Moderna retejoj - ĝi estas vera sperto, la reala mondo taskoj. Ili nur bezonas labori bone kaj montri plata tridimensian bildon.
Parenteze, la fenomeno de la surteriĝo paĝo (surteriĝo paĝo) en la formo de ebloj "ejo konstruaĵo" - la plej bona pruvo ke la plata rektangula formo kaj seka, sed ekstreme preciza enhavo - ankaŭ bona kaj praktika. Sed ni notu, ke la lokoj de la monopolon firmaoj batita al ilia ĉefa afero - la vizaĝo de la firmao, lia funcionalidad kaj potenco produktado. Informo Teknologio Monstroj sentis surteriĝo paĝoj - estas malgrandaj entreprenoj alfrontas, akcesoraj, Herbalife kaj aliaj "juveloj".
Kiel ĝin aŭ ne, fakte ĝusta, la estonteco montros. Gravas, ke ne nur havas sencon pentri en tavoloj enhavo, sed ankaŭ por certigi taŭgan movado inter ili en iu varianto de konstruado de retejo.
Bonege solvo - AJAX (paĝo estas ĝisdatigita laŭbezone). Eĉ pli promesplenaj solvo, kiam la paĝo montras, ke necesas en ĉi tiu punkto de la retumilo fenestro.
Fakte, z-indekso - ĉi simpla regulo CSS. Lia celo - montri la nivelon de la etikedo por ke la retumilo povas determini kiam la display elemento kaj kiu parto de ĉi tiu elemento estos videbla. Mantelo kaj la paĝo - tre relativa nocio, ĉar ĝi estas problema por desegni la paĝo kaj memoru la signifo de Regulo z-indekso por malsamaj enhavo montriĝo.
Tipe, ellaboranto elektas ŝatata nombro, kaj donas ĝin al ĉiuj etikedoj en vico, kaj la fakto ke ni devas iel elstaras, atribuas la sekva nombro. Aligu gravecon al la tavoloj kaj nivelojn de paĝoj - ne estas aparte progresema kaj promesplena praktikojn.
Tamen, se la movo semantiko z-indekso por dialogo kun la vizitanto, eblas krei praktika efiko. Simila al kiel etikedoj povas esti aldonitan al la alia, eblas trudi dialogon (retejon vizitanto) kaj plenumi movado inter ili. De ĉi tiu perspektivo, la aplikado de la reguloj de CSS z-indekso ŝajnas esti tre factible kaj praktika.
Similar articles
Trending Now